[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#62751: 29.0.90; New libraries that still need to be assigned to pack
From: |
Jonas Bernoulli |
Subject: |
bug#62751: 29.0.90; New libraries that still need to be assigned to packages |
Date: |
Thu, 21 Sep 2023 23:12:21 +0200 |
Stefan Kangas <stefankangas@gmail.com> writes:
> Jonas Bernoulli <jonas@bernoul.li> writes:
>
>> There are three more libraries that deserve some attention:
>>
>> - lisp/obsolete/otodo-mode.el
>>
>> formerly known as todo-mode.el, was obsoleted a decade ago.
>> Has the time for its removal come now? ;)
>
> otodo-mode.el was obsoleted in Emacs 24.4, which according to
> etc/HISTORY was released on 2014-10-20.
>
> We typically keep stuff on master for 10 years after it was marked
> obsolete in a release. Doing it that way gives the community plenty of
> time to adapt, and keeping obsolete stuff around is usually more or less
> harmless.
>
> We delete stuff faster only if there's a clear reason for it, for
> example that it's clearly broken and/or harmful. See browse-url.el for
> some examples of the former.
>
>> - lisp/obsolete/crisp.el
>> - lisp/obsolete/landmark.el
>>
>> are available from GNU ELPA, so it seems unnecessary to keep
>> them in emacs.git as well.
>
> You're not wrong, but they were obsoleted in 24.5 and 25.1. So it's
> like above, but the dates are in 2025 and 2026, or something like that.
Alright. Thanks for the clarification.
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, (continued)
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Eli Zaretskii, 2023/09/21
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Kangas, 2023/09/21
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Monnier, 2023/09/18
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Kangas, 2023/09/20
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Jonas Bernoulli, 2023/09/18
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Jonas Bernoulli, 2023/09/20
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Jonas Bernoulli, 2023/09/18
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Kangas, 2023/09/20
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ages,
Jonas Bernoulli <=
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Monnier, 2023/09/22
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Kangas, 2023/09/23
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Richard Stallman, 2023/09/19
- bug#62751: 29.0.90; New libraries that still need to be assigned to packages, Stefan Kangas, 2023/09/20